Application Scenarios

This dryer is highly suitable for multiple scenarios. It can efficiently relieve wood stress, especially in the secondary drying and moisture - balancing process of wood. For large - section thick wood, hardwoods (especially precious woods like rosewood), it enables rapid drying. It is also ideal for small - batch wood drying, as well as drying floor veneers and wood veneers.

Key Features

  1. Uniform Heating and Rapid Drying: The dryer ensures even heat distribution throughout the wood, which is crucial for consistent drying. This uniform heating not only speeds up the drying process but also reduces the risk of wood deformation. For instance, it can lower the moisture content of wood from around 20% to 12% in just 20 - 45 minutes, making it highly efficient.

  2. High - Quality Materials:

    • The entire tank is made of 304 stainless steel. This material is highly resistant to wear and low temperatures. It also has excellent heat - preservation properties, which helps in maintaining a stable drying environment. Additionally, it is easy to clean and maintain.

    • The stainless - steel vacuum pump is corrosion - resistant and pollution - free. It has multiple functions and is highly water - saving, ensuring reliable and efficient operation.

    • The stainless - steel solenoid valve has features like no external leakage, easy internal - leakage control, and safe operation. It has a fast - acting response, low power consumption, and a compact design.

    • The 304 stainless - steel cooling tower is resistant to corrosion and high temperatures. Its excellent heat - resistant performance prevents high - temperature oxidation, ensuring long - term stable operation.

  3. User - friendly Operation: It features a touch - screen operation interface for easy control. The dryer is automated, which simplifies the operation process. With high energy - utilization efficiency, it is energy - saving and cost - effective. It also requires less manual intervention, reducing labor costs.

  4. Enhanced Wood Quality:

    • The drying process is gentle yet effective, ensuring that the dried wood is uniform and has high toughness. This is beneficial for maintaining the structural integrity of the wood.

    • By penetrating the wood with heat, it can kill parasite eggs, preventing wood from being damaged by insects and mold. This significantly extends the storage life of the wood.
